The biggest ecommerce day in November? It’s not Black Friday.

November 14, 2014November 6, 2014 by John Yunker

In China, November 11th is known as Singles Day and it has quickly become the world’s biggest day for ecommerce. Tmall, the massive ecommerce website owned by Alibaba is already promoting this day: Tmall hosts a great number of Western …

Xiaomi launches Mi.com as its global “front door”

May 1, 2014April 29, 2014 by John Yunker

I’ve long been curious how Xiaomi would take its brand name global. The name itself can be challenging for us Western speakers to pronounce, let alone spell correctly. That’s not to say the name is destined to fail, as foreign brand …

Xiaomi’s global expansion plans include Malaysia, Indonesia, Thailand

April 14, 2014 by John Yunker

In January, I wrote about Xiaomi’s success in crowdsourced translation of its operating system — and how this bodes well for global expansion. Xiaomi, for those who’ve never heard of it, is a fast-growing mobile phone company in China — …
